Joshua Kerry of Rotherham, South Yorkshire, appeared in a London court on Tuesday charged with the murder of former British MP Ann Widdecombe. Prosecutors stated that the 78-year-old politician died after an attack at her home in Haytor, Devon, where the perpetrator allegedly struck her repeatedly in the head with a hammer on July 8. zpravy.aktualne.cz ↗

According to prosecutors, Widdecombe was struck 21 times. The attack is said to have taken place in the kitchen while she was having lunch. The prosecution claims that Kerry arrived at the house by car, entered through the main entrance, and left with her wallet after the attack. He is said to have spent approximately two minutes at the scene. Part of the incident was reportedly captured by security cameras and a doorbell camera, according to the court. HVG ↗

Widdecombe was found dead on July 9 after she failed to appear for a scheduled online interview and her colleagues were unable to reach her. The provisional cause of death is a head injury caused by a blunt object. Kerry confirmed his identity at the hearing but did not enter a plea. The court remanded him in custody and referred the case to the Old Bailey. NOS ↗

Investigators continue to examine the motive for the attack, including a possible political or terrorist connection. Widdecombe was a longtime Conservative Party MP, later a Member of the European Parliament and a Reform UK spokesperson. Further hearings are expected to determine the procedural course of the case.
